### v3.2.0 — Renamed setting

Keyspindle no longer reads `KS_ROTATE_TOKEN`; it was renamed for consistency with the plugin API. Plugins targeting 3.2+ must use the new name or rotation hooks will not fire. The old name is ignored silently — no deprecation warning is emitted. Update your `.env` before upgrading. Keep `KS_PLUGIN_DIR` and `KS_LOG_LEVEL` as-is. Immediately after those entries, add the renamed token line with your existing value.

secret setting of kawif-kajef: COURIER_KEY3=d2b

- [ ] **Stale-branch cleanup bot:** Confirm the Twigreaper bot is paused for the release window so it does not delete the release branch or any hotfix candidates. Re-enable it after the tag is pushed. Record the paused state in the release log alongside the build token noted below.

session token of bagep-yaduf = htk6_9cf8de

- [ ] Verify offline mode for Fernwick Survey sync queue. Before tagging the release, confirm that field entries created without connectivity are persisted locally, deduplicated on reconnect, and that plugin hooks fire exactly once per record. Third-party plugins must not assume network availability during the `onRecordSave` callback. Run the airplane-mode suite twice and record the results. Paste the build token from the passing run directly beneath this item.

session token of fahap-hawip = htk31_7852f2b3276dba2738f98fa97f92237

## Digestly 3.0 — new scheduling defaults

Heads up, plugin folks: batch email digests no longer fire at the top of every hour by default. We now jitter sends across a 15-minute window and cap each batch at 500 recipients, which cut our spike load roughly in half during testing. If your plugin assumed exact hourly delivery, you'll want to hook the new `digest.window` event instead of hardcoding timestamps. Everything is overridable per tenant, of course. Here are the defaults your plugins will inherit on upgrade.

deployment values, taweg-bajop:
[fenvan]
port = 5672
team = holmir
host = fenvan.orvexio.example
region = lower-1
access_code = ac_b98bc6
timeout_ms = 1500